froh vs freuen

to look forward / to be pleased

„Sich freuen“ and „froh sein“ can both express a positive reaction to something. „Sich freuen“ tends to emphasize joy about an event, while „froh“ can also suggest relief or an already existing state. Choose „froh“ when you are especially relieved; otherwise, „sich freuen“ is often suitable.

Visual example for freuen
froh

Ich bin froh, dass die gute Nachricht heute endlich gekommen ist.

I am glad that the good news finally arrived today.

freuen

Ich freue mich über die gute Nachricht von heute.

I am pleased about today's good news.
